    The Magic Behind the Ice: Gathering and Preparation

    Alright, let's get into the nitty-gritty of how these amazing ice structures come to life. First off, you might be wondering: where does all that ice come from? Well, it's not like they have a giant ice-making machine! Instead, they rely on the region’s natural resources. Usually, the ice is harvested from frozen rivers and lakes. Think of it as a giant ice harvest! Workers carefully cut out massive blocks of ice, often weighing hundreds of kilograms each. This process requires precision and skill, as the quality of the ice directly affects the final product. The purer and clearer the ice, the better the light refraction, which is crucial for creating that magical, glowing effect you often see in the finished structures. Once the ice blocks are cut, they're transported to the construction site. Given their weight and the quantities needed, this is no small feat! Special vehicles and equipment are used to move the ice without damaging it. After arriving at the site, the ice blocks are stored carefully, often covered with insulating materials to prevent them from melting prematurely. Now, here’s a fun fact: the timing of the ice harvest is crucial. It needs to be done when the ice is thick enough to be safe to cut and transport but before the weather gets too warm, which could cause the ice to become unstable. It’s a delicate balance, folks!     Construction Techniques: Building the Impossible

    So, how do you actually build something out of ice? It's not like you can just slap some glue on it, right? Well, the construction of these ice wonders involves a blend of traditional methods and modern techniques. Think of it as a cool fusion of art and engineering! One of the primary methods used is ice bonding. This involves using water as a kind of “glue” to fuse the ice blocks together. The water freezes almost instantly in the sub-zero temperatures, creating a strong bond between the blocks. It’s a bit like welding, but with ice! The builders have to be incredibly precise with their angles and measurements, ensuring that each block fits perfectly. Any gaps or misalignments could weaken the structure, and nobody wants an ice castle collapsing, right? To reinforce the structures, builders often use internal supports made of steel or wood. These supports provide additional stability and help distribute the weight of the ice. It’s like building a skeleton for the ice structure! Another technique involves carving and sculpting the ice. Skilled artisans use a variety of tools, from chisels and saws to more modern equipment like ice grinders, to shape the ice into intricate designs. This requires a steady hand and an artistic eye. They sculpt everything from delicate floral patterns to massive ice dragons. Lighting plays a crucial role in bringing these ice structures to life. LED lights are embedded within the ice, creating stunning visual effects. The light refracts through the ice crystals, producing a mesmerizing glow that highlights the intricate details of the sculptures.     Popular Ice World Attractions in China

    So, where can you witness these spectacular ice builds in China? Well, there are a few key locations that are famous for their annual ice festivals and attractions. Let's dive into some of the most popular ones! First up, we have the Harbin International Ice and Snow Sculpture Festival. This is probably the most well-known and largest ice festival in the world. Held annually in Harbin, Heilongjiang province, it features massive ice sculptures, illuminated ice buildings, and a variety of winter activities. The scale of the sculptures is truly mind-boggling, with some structures reaching over 40 meters in height. You can explore ice castles, ice slides, and even ice hotels! The festival attracts millions of visitors from around the world each year and is a must-see for anyone interested in ice architecture. Next, we have the Ice and Snow World in Harbin. This is another major attraction in Harbin that showcases the artistry of ice and snow. Unlike the festival, which is a one-time event, Ice and Snow World is a permanent park that operates throughout the winter season. It features a variety of ice sculptures, illuminated buildings, and interactive exhibits. You can even try ice skating or snow tubing! The park is constantly evolving, with new attractions and sculptures added each year. Another notable location is the Jilin Rime Ice and Snow Festival in Jilin province. While this festival is not solely focused on ice architecture, it does feature some impressive ice sculptures and illuminated displays. The festival is also known for its stunning rime ice formations, which occur when water vapor freezes onto trees and other surfaces, creating a magical winter landscape.     The Environmental Impact and Sustainability

    Okay, let's get real for a second. While these ice structures are undeniably breathtaking, it's important to consider their environmental impact. Building with ice might seem like a sustainable choice since it melts away in the spring, but there are still factors to consider. One of the main concerns is the energy used to harvest, transport, and store the ice. Cutting massive blocks of ice from frozen rivers and lakes requires heavy machinery, which consumes fuel and emits greenhouse gases. Transporting the ice to the construction site also involves energy consumption. Additionally, storing the ice to prevent it from melting prematurely requires energy-intensive refrigeration systems. Another factor to consider is the water used to create the ice. While the water eventually returns to the environment when the ice melts, the process of freezing and thawing can have an impact on local water resources. In recent years, there has been a growing emphasis on sustainability in the construction of ice structures. Builders are exploring ways to reduce their environmental footprint by using more energy-efficient equipment, optimizing transportation routes, and minimizing water usage. Some are even experimenting with alternative ice-making techniques that require less energy. One approach is to use natural freezing processes to create ice blocks. This involves allowing water to freeze naturally in shallow ponds or basins, rather than using energy-intensive refrigeration systems. Another strategy is to use recycled water to create the ice. This helps to conserve water resources and reduce the demand for fresh water. Furthermore, some builders are incorporating renewable energy sources, such as solar power, to power their construction and storage operations.
